Talent Development Consultant

Houston, TX, United States

At Lockton, we’re passionate about helping our people achieve their ultimate potential. Our people are curious, action-oriented and always striving to make ourselves and those around us better. We’re active listeners working to ensure understanding and problem solvers developing innovative solutions. If you can see yourself delivering excellent service to clients, giving back to our communities and being a part of our caring culture, you belong here.

Secondary locations Dallas

Business unit Texas Series

Schedule Full-time

Job type Standard

Workplace Hybrid

Your Responsibilities Lockton is currently seeking a seasoned Learning and Development professional to join our Texas Team! As a key member of our People and Culture Team, you will be responsible for leading the learning experience and supporting Associate development. This is a critical role to the business; as the success of our Associates significantly impact the company’s future business growth, knowledge capital, and builds successful leadership. The Talent Development Consultant will develop and deliver curated learning at all levels across the Texas Series and contribute to the day-to-day activities of the Human Resources team.

ASSOCIATE DEVELOPMENT:

• Assess developmental needs for internal teams and Associates

• Establish job competencies and provide guidance to develop and grow Associate's career pathing (educational, emotional, and professional).

• Lead appropriate goal setting for Associates that align with their career aspirations and Series’ expectations

• Assist Associates with pursuit of various Certification and Professional Designation Programs

• Serve as a Clifton Strengths Champion for the Texas Series

ASSOCIATE LEARNING:

• Responsible for a variety of training programs (including oversight and delegation of activities) and ensuring alignment with Associate development plans including; Resourcing of presentation materials, Brainstorm subject matter for presentations, Logistical scheduling, Maintenance of Associate training records.

• Assess the effectiveness of training relating to associate accomplishment and performance

• Develop, monitor, and actively engage in Leadership Development programming

• Partner closely with the Texas Trainer and provide technical and administrative support to ensure successful execution of learning strategies, projects and events

• Introduce new resources, tools, and technology that support and lift our internal learning and development experience

• Research external resources for up-to-date materials for current curriculum, presentations and potential for new classes

• Manage and oversee Lockton’s Summer Internship Program in collaboration with internal SME’s and Talent Acquisition Team

STRATEGIC RELATIONSHIPS:

• Utilize the ADDIE (Analyze, Design, Develop, Implement, Evaluate) Approach to find the best, curated solutions for our teams and leaders.

• Support a dynamic on-boarding experience and continuity planning of Associates to support future growth

• Develop and nurture relationships with Lockton Global Learning and Development leads

• Build a vibrant social media presence within our internal social media platform

• Lead as a Lockton Brand Ambassador internally and externally, including representation at industry functions

• Support the HR leader with strategy updates, communication, and marketing

• Collaborate with the Talent Acquisition team regarding workforce planning

Qualifications • Bachelor’s degree relating to Training and Development and/or Organizational Development

• Minimum of 5 years’ experience in a Learning and/or Organizational Development role (Corporate training, facilitation and/or advisory experience required)

• PHR/SPHR certification (preferred)

• Proficient with Microsoft Office products (Excel, PowerPoint, Word, and Outlook)

• Prior work experience in the insurance and/or financial sector (required)

• Technical experience in the commercial insurance field (strongly preferred)

• Ability to identify, assess, coach, and mentor Associates in their developmental growth

• Extensive experience analyzing individual development needs related to both technical and soft skills and determining most effective training methods and processes

• Experience in curriculum design and facilitating training and coaching sessions across a variety of platforms (virtual and in-person)

• Fundamental understanding of adult learning principles

• Working knowledge of the Clifton Strengths platform and program (preferred)

• Leadership and problem-solving skills, including resolving complex issues

• Consistently demonstrate interpersonal communication skills and ability to interact with Associates at all levels of responsibility

• Strong team player with the ability to share responsibilities and promote a team environment amongst departments and locations

• Ability to be flexible in a dynamic, fast-paced, ever-changing environment

• Exemplary presentation skills (preparation and execution), including professional written and verbal communication skills

• Comfortable speaking to audiences of all sizes and personalities

• Must be able to prioritize a heavy workload with effective organizational and time management skills

• Ability to work in a hybrid environment (3 days in office) and travel (50%) to supported offices
